Gitea 1.15.8 发布
·阅读时长:2 分钟
我们很自豪地发布 Gitea 1.15.8 版本。
我们强烈建议用户更新到此版本,因为其中包含一些重要的错误修复。
我们合并了 16 个拉取请求来发布此版本。
❗我们提醒用户,在 1.14.3–1.14.6 和 1.15.0 中发现了 gitea dump
的一个错误。这些版本生成的数据库转储会导致 repo_unit
和 login_source
表中的字段损坏,从而导致 #16961 中标识的问题。1.14.x 上的用户必须先升级到 1.14.7,然后再运行 gitea dump
。如果无法做到这一点,并且您受到了影响,#17137 提供了一个新的 gitea doctor
命令来修复 repo_unit
问题
gitea doctor --fix --run fix-broken-repo-units
您可以从我们的 下载页面 下载预编译二进制文件之一 - 请确保选择正确的平台!有关如何安装的更多详细信息,请遵循我们的 安装指南。
我们还要感谢我们 Open Collective 上的所有支持者,他们帮助我们从经济上维持运作。
您听说过吗?我们现在有一个 商品商店!:shirt🍵
更改日志
1.15.8 - 2021-12-20
- BUG 修复
- 将 POST
/{username}/action/{action}
迁移到简单的 POST/{username}
(#18045) (#18046) - 修复删除 u2f 密钥的错误 (#18040) (#18042)
- 在登录时重置会话 ID (#18018) (#18041)
- 防止对新添加行上的注释出现越界错误 (#18029) (#18035)
- 停止在日志中打印转义字符后的 03d (#18030) (#18034)
- 在登录时重置语言环境 (#18023) (#18025)
- 修复重置密码电子邮件模板 (#17025) (#18022)
- 修复
gitea dump
上的outType
(#18000) (#18016) - 确保在设置密码时检查复杂度、最小长度和 isPwned (#18005) (#18015)
- 修复重命名通知错误 (#18011)
- 防止对 URL 参数中的 % 进行双重解码 (#17997) (#18001)
- 防止在仓库不是有效仓库时,git cat-file 中出现挂起(部分 #17991) (#17992)
- 防止在创建问题时出现死锁 (#17970) (#17982)
- 将 POST
- 测试